Triboluminescence and/or Fractoluminescence
are optical phenomenon, forms of mechanoluminescence in which light is generated through the rubbing (tribo) or breaking (fracto) of chemical bonds in a material when it is
pulled apart, ripped, scratched, crushed, or rubbed.
Unlike piezoluminescence, the material emits light when it is broken, not deformed.
This effect is not fully understood by our current conceptual models of science but it is thought that upon fracture of asymmetrical materials, there is a separation and reunification of electrical charge.
When the charges recombine the electric discharge ionizes the surrounding air and causes a flash of light.
The observation of Triboluminescence in a mercury filled barometer led to the discovery of the Barometric light which while investigating researchers discovered that static electricity could cause low-pressure air to glow, which revealed the possibility of electric lightening!!!
